'It will be fun!'
That was what her best friend Julie said. The best friend her parents hated. The best friend that the entire town called a bad influence. 'The Party of Year' is what her friend had called it, but as nineteen year old Hayley Marshall stood in front of the rented out apartment complex, she was starting to wonder if every adult in her life had been right about her 'best friend'.
Hayley Marshall, had never done a thing wrong. Never missed a day of high school and had only ever been on a date that her father approved of. Now that golden girl was about to explore a territory she had never explored before. The high school graduate pulled furiously at the hem of the tight mini denim skirt she had been forced to wear. Of course, it should not feel entirely bad for any girl to dress revealing, but wearing your petite friend's skimpy clothing when you were 5'10" just accentuated everything. The denim skirt barely skirted her thigh, and Hayley did not even want to focus on the ridiculous boots or even the tank top that was just as bad. Apparently to everyone else in the world, she looked amazing, but in Hayley's opinion she looked like a stripper. Looking like a stripper and standing in uneasiness at the open front door, the girl wanted to kick herself. She had never tried a drop of alcohol, or even thought of smoking the 'good stuff'. This kind of life had never beckoned her, so why should she try now?
Inside the apartment, the world of books and conservative dress manners seemed to slip away. Bodies danced together like they were all part of the same being, the stench of alcohol and who knows what watered the eyes of everyone, but not one person seemed to be frowning. It was a sense of freedom and rebelliousness that Hayley had never seen or experienced before, and she was wondering if her friend was right about all of it. It could indeed be fun, if she braved herself enough to actually partake in any of these activities.
"Hayley stop standing over there like a stoner and come and meet a friend of mine." Immediately Hayley was drawn from her trance of the sea of partiers, realizing she had been standing in the lobby of the apartment, staring at everyone like she had never seen anything like it before. In truth she had not, but it wasn't the best aura to present herself as. Whoever this person her friend Julie wanted her to meet must have been incredibly important, because Julie never introduced her to anyone. "Hayley, this is my friend Enzo, he's like the raddest of all partiers. Totally hot too. He was friends with Beth until Beth moved and then I met him. Totally weird huh?"
Hayley pursed her lips at Julie's annoying barbie toned voice, wondering what kind of guy this Enzo must be if he could put up with her on a regular basis. But one thing was for certain, Julie was correct on Enzo being a looker. He probably had to be one of the nicer looking guys Hayley had met. Though he seemed to be staring at her in a judgmental manner. Perhaps he could sense her unfamiliarity with the party atmosphere and thought she was a ditz. Probably so.
"Hi, I'm Hayley, I've been friends with Julie since first grade, so I know you must put up with a lot of stuff." She joked awkwardly, still trying to get him to say something and stop looking at her like she could be some sort of broken child. The girl turned to talk to her friend, but tragically Julie had been distracted and wandered off to talk to some other sorority girls she probably knew. Great. She was alone with Mr. Enzo. "Great party tonight. I mean this is really raving on." But every word that seemed to leave her mouth just seemed to make her sound more like the stupid and inexperienced person she was, which was not how she planned on introducing herself to anyone at this rave.
